2025 Polaris Ranger Crew 1000: A Comprehensive Overview

The 2025 Polaris Ranger Crew 1000 is a highly anticipated addition to the Ranger lineup. This versatile and capable side-by-side offers an array of features and enhancements that make it an ideal choice for work, play, and adventure. Here’s a comprehensive overview of its key aspects:

Engine and Performance: The Ranger Crew 1000 boasts a powerful 999cc ProStar engine that delivers exceptional torque and acceleration. It features a three-mode throttle system that allows you to customize the performance to suit varying conditions. You can choose between “Work” mode for heavy-duty tasks, “Standard” mode for general use, and “Performance” mode for maximum power and speed.

Handling and Suspension: The Ranger Crew 1000 is equipped with a robust suspension system that provides a smooth and controlled ride. It features an independent front suspension with dual A-arms and 10 inches of travel. The rear suspension system consists of a dual A-arm setup with a trailing arm and 11 inches of travel. This combination ensures optimal stability and handling in rough terrains.

Cargo Capacity and Towing: The Ranger Crew 1000 offers an impressive cargo capacity of 1,000 pounds and a towing capacity of 2,500 pounds. It comes with a spacious cargo bed that can accommodate large loads. The bed also features integrated tie-down points for secure cargo storage.

Exploring Synergistic Abilities: Ranger and Other Classes

Druid: A Force of Nature

Two classes inherently entwined with the natural world, the Ranger and Druid complement each other beautifully. The shared casting stat of Wisdom unlocks a vast pool of potent spells. Circle of the Moon grants wild shape, allowing a Ranger to transform into a formidable predator or enhance their versatility with the Shapeshifting feature. Additionally, the Circle of Stars grants access to the Guidance cantrip, enhancing the Ranger’s already impressive tracking and exploration capabilities.

Cleric: Divine Intervention

The Ranger’s unwavering connection to the natural world finds resonance with the Cleric’s devout faith. As both classes prioritize Wisdom, the multiclass synergizes seamlessly. Cleric subclasses offer an array of Divine Domains that enhance combat effectiveness, including the War Domain for martial prowess, the Forge Domain for heavy armor and weapon enhancements, and the Trickery Domain for added mobility and deceit.

Fighter: Martial Superiority

The Ranger and Fighter embody the essence of combat prowess. A multiclass benefits from the Fighter’s Action Surge, allowing the Ranger to unleashed multiple attacks or employ a devastating spell twice in a single turn. Battle Master maneuvers further enhance the Ranger’s tactical versatility, while the Cavalier subclass grants access to a mount for enhanced mobility and protection. Moreover, the Champion subclass bestows critical hit bonuses, maximizing the Ranger’s damage output.

Rogue: Stealth and Deception

The Ranger’s natural stealth and perception blend seamlessly with the Rogue’s cunning. A multiclass grants expertise in Stealth, enhancing the Ranger’s ability to move undetected. Sneak Attack combines with the Ranger’s archery proficiency for devastating damage on vulnerable targets. The Arcane Trickster subclass bestows spellcasting abilities, and the Mastermind subclass provides bonuses to Charisma-based skills, further enhancing the Ranger’s social interactions.

The Unseen Ally: Ranger Multiclassing with Clerics

Combining the wilderness prowess of the Ranger with the divine power of the Cleric can create a formidable multiclass option in Baldur’s Gate 3. Clerics contribute healing spells, defensive buffs, and a surprising amount of damage output.

Multiclassing Requirements

To multiclass into Cleric, your Ranger must meet the following ability score requirement: Wisdom 13.

Ranger Subclass Selection

The best Ranger subclasses for a multiclass with Cleric are Beast Master and Gloomstalker. Beast Master’s animal companion can provide additional utility and combat support, while Gloomstalker’s ambush expertise synergizes well with the Cleric’s damage spells.

### Cleric Subclass Selection

The best Cleric subclasses for a Ranger multiclass are Life and Forge. Life Cleric’s healing spells keep allies alive, while Forge Cleric’s armor proficiency and Divine Strike feature enhance combat effectiveness.

### Ability Score Prioritization

The most important ability scores for a Ranger/Cleric multiclass are Wisdom (for spellcasting and AC), Dexterity (for initiative and ranged attacks), and Constitution (for hit points and concentration checks).

### Skill Selection

Ranger skills such as Survival, Perception, and Animal Handling complement Cleric skills like Insight, Religion, and Medicine.

### Spell Selection

Cleric spells that complement Ranger abilities include Bless, Cure Wounds, Divine Favor, and Spiritual Weapon. These spells enhance damage, healing, and utility.

### Class Level Progression

The ideal class level progression for a Ranger/Cleric multiclass is 5 levels in Ranger followed by 5 levels in Cleric. This allows for a balance between the Ranger’s combat prowess and the Cleric’s healing and support capabilities.

### Equipment and Feats

Magic items that boost Wisdom or Dexterity are beneficial. Feats such as Sharpshooter or Crossbow Expert improve ranged damage output, while War Caster or Resilient (Wisdom) enhance concentration and spellcasting.

### Role in the Party

Ranger/Cleric multiclasses are versatile characters that can excel in both combat and support roles. They are particularly effective in parties that lack a dedicated healer or tank.

The Ford Edge: Reimagined for the 21st Century

The Ford Edge has been a popular choice for families and individuals alike since its introduction in 2006. For 2025, the Edge has been completely reimagined to meet the needs of today’s drivers.

Redesigned Exterior

The 2025 Edge features a sleek and modern exterior design. The front fascia has been redesigned with a new grille and headlights, and the rear of the vehicle has been updated with new taillights and a more aerodynamic shape.

Spacious and Comfortable Interior

The interior of the 2025 Edge has been designed to be both spacious and comfortable. The front seats offer plenty of headroom and legroom, and the rear seats are spacious enough for three adults to sit comfortably.

High-Tech Features

The 2025 Edge comes standard with a host of high-tech features, including a 12-inch touchscreen infotainment system, a digital instrument cluster, and a suite of driver-assist technologies.

Available Hybrid Powertrain

For the first time, the Edge is available with a hybrid powertrain. The hybrid system pairs a 2.0-liter EcoBoost engine with an electric motor to provide both fuel efficiency and power.

Available All-Wheel Drive

All-wheel drive is available on all trim levels of the 2025 Edge, providing drivers with increased traction in all weather conditions.

Trim Levels

The 2025 Edge is available in four trim levels: SE, SEL, ST-Line, and Titanium.

Pricing

Pricing for the 2025 Edge starts at $32,500 for the SE trim level. The SEL trim level starts at $35,000, the ST-Line trim level starts at $38,000, and the Titanium trim level starts at $41,000.

Specifications:

Length: 192.8 inches
Width: 75.9 inches
Height: 68.1 inches
Wheelbase: 112.2 inches
Curb weight: 3,880 pounds
Engine: 2.0-liter EcoBoost engine
Transmission: 8-speed automatic transmission
Fuel economy: 25 mpg city / 31 mpg highway
Capacity: 5 passengers
Towing capacity: 3,500 pounds
